Start Off Strong With Dimensional Lumber Dimensional lumber refers to softwood lumber that has been milled on all sides to common sizes, including 2 by 4, 2 by 8, 2 by 10 and 2 by 12. They're commonly used in structural construction projects such as framing ... WebSep 5, 2024 · Use a circular saw. These are used for cutting timber, MDF, block board and ply board. It makes direct line cuts. Like with a jigsaw, the actual cut is done as the cutting blades rise up-wards through the timber, so the neatest side will be on the underneath. Use a wood chisel to split the damaged board into two pieces. Doing so makes removal easier. Pry out the damaged board. If you take a strip out of the middle you can pry the remaining pieces away from the adjacent boards before prying them up.

With a beautiful combination of wood, metal and an … how to speak cursiveWebAug 26, 2024 · You can make a sanding block by cutting a small square of rigid foam or gluing a thin layer of cork to a wood block. Or you can buy a simple rubber sanding block at almost any hardware store, paint store or home center.
